Dingmans Ferry

This morning VANilla carted me and the dogs from Ted’s House to Dingmans Ferry within the Delaware Water Gap National Recreation Area. The Delaware Water Gap National Recreation Area is located on the border of New Jersey and Pennsylvania.  Here, I took a 10 minute walk past two lovely waterfalls on the Delaware River.  The first, Silver Thread Falls, is aptly named as the narrow stream of water that tumbles down the cliff looks like a silver thread.  The second, 130 foot Dingmans Falls, curves over the granite rock.

High Point State Park

After a repeat visit to the Walmart where I spent Thursday night, I headed off to High Point State Park in New Jersey.  The park is complete with lakes, trails crisscrossing through the forest, and even an obelisk that sits atop the Kittatinny Ridge.  The dogs and I took the scenic drive up to the 1,800 foot summit.
